Output 6303275b6ed13d868c74162a16bb1c7b627b8484579c06a951855be47d56f40f:0

value
57862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71438371163599e4a44fc27aec99270f0214ab9 OP_EQUAL
address
3MJFRfkxMh58fHb5BmdQPCAKs5HyASik3V
transaction
6303275b6ed13d868c74162a16bb1c7b627b8484579c06a951855be47d56f40f